In situ concrete mattress protection with open hole porosity have been developed and used over the last 10 years as scour protection to wave zones. The paper will present a design method based upon comparison to guidance provided by HR Wallingford [8] following scale model testing on concrete slabbing with gaps. This will allow wider consideration and use of this new protection. Open Hole Mattress is particularly useful to wave zones under open piled jetties where it can readily be installed and pump filled with concrete under piled platforms. Case histories of port applications from Guatemala, USA and Iraq will be presented. A case history of use on the Brahmaputra River in Bangladesh will also be provided where Open Hole Mattress was made in the local natural jute material. The case histories will demonstrate use of the protection system and its use in developing countries.
